Direct Relief Boosts PPE Deliveries to Hotspots as COVID-19 Cases Reach New Highs in U.S.

SANTA BARBARA, California, Nov. 6 -- Direct Relief issued the following news:
The United States is setting records for daily Covid-19 cases, with more than 100,000 cases recorded on Wednesday.
